Grand Traverse County Board approves two‑year funding pledge to help Safe Harbor operate year‑round shelter

Grand Traverse County Board of Commissioners · February 5, 2025
AI-Generated Content: All content on this page was generated by AI to highlight key points from the meeting. For complete details and context, we recommend watching the full video. so we can fix them.

Summary

The Grand Traverse County Board of Commissioners approved a resolution to provide Safe Harbor $200,000 in 2025 and to budget $200,000 for 2026 to support a year‑round emergency shelter; the measure includes monthly metrics and a service agreement, and passed after discussion on funding source and oversight.

The Grand Traverse County Board of Commissioners voted to support Safe Harbor’s plan to run a year‑round emergency overnight shelter by approving a resolution that commits $200,000 for 2025 and budgets $200,000 for 2026, subject to a service agreement and agreed reporting metrics.

At a presentation to the board, Sakura Takano, CEO of Rotary Charities, and Patrick Livingston, chair of Safe Harbor’s board, described the shelter as a volunteer‑run nonprofit that runs a 74‑bed seasonal operation and estimates a year‑round budget of about $1.1 million.
